An iPhone and Apple Watch app for finding friends in crowds, checking in, messaging your crew, and monitoring shared safety signals.

Why it surfaced

BeatWatch turns festival coordination into a compact set of tools: Friend Compass, SOS, BRB check-ins, live BPM, reminders, maps, and set times. Its homepage also stages a glossy festival-life narrative—from packing champagne to the front of the stage—while plainly labeling the scenes as dramatization.
